The Russian Federation handed over to the Ukrainian side the bodies of 1,212 servicemen of the Armed Forces of Ukraine (AFU), who were delivered to a pre-agreed place on June 8.
The transfer is reported today, June 11, by the Ukrainian edition of Strana, referring to the Kiev Coordination Headquarters for the Treatment of prisoners of war. The article recalls that in total the Russians in Istanbul promised to transfer 6,000 bodies to Ukraine.
"Over the weekend, Moscow accused Ukraine of refusing to take the first batch of bodies. In response, Ukraine accused Russia of manipulation," the statement said.
There is no confirmation of the transfer of bodies from the Russian side yet. According to unconfirmed information, the Ukrainian side handed over to Russia only 27 bodies of fighters RF Armed Forces.
Recall that on June 8, foreign journalists arrived in the Bryansk region, where refrigerated trucks with the bodies of servicemen of the Armed Forces of Ukraine are located.
The Russian side was ready to fulfill all agreements with Ukraine in the context of the exchange of prisoners of war and the transfer of bodies. However, Kiev postponed the transfer date indefinitely without explaining the reasons.
